  • Abstract
    The use of linear precoding in bit-interleaved coded modulation with iterative decoding leads to a significant performance improvement on AWGN channels. In this contribution, we approach linear precoding from an information theoretical perspective. We compute the bitwise capacity as seen by each of the precoder inputs in order to investigate the impact of precoding for two scenarios: using (i) a non-iterative decoder and (ii) an iterative decoder under a perfect feedback assumption. When restricting to BPSK signaling, the bitwise capacity reveals simple precoding design rules for both scenarios. Simulation results confirm our analytical findings
